About BEDGEAR® PERFORMANCE®
Launched in 2009, BEDGEAR® is the brand of Performance® that provides innovative bedding by focusing on an active lifestyle and well-being. BEDGEAR’s sleep solutions are engineered with Performance fabrics that are temperature neutral and instant cooling and maximizes airflow to allow the body to naturally regulate its temperature. With a core belief of One Size Does Not Fit All™, BEDGEAR has redefined the way people view sleep by developing interactive in-store experiences and breathable bedding products that are personally fit to a consumer based on specific factors, including body type, sleep position and temperature. BEDGEAR is dedicated to integrating environmental responsibility into product development to ensure less returned goods are being sent to landfills. BEDGEAR is essential to the rest and recovery routines of professional athletes and active people who need to maximize their sleep. A proud manufacturer in the USA, BEDGEAR offers mattresses, pillows, sheets, blankets, pet beds as well as travel, kids and baby products that often feature removable and washable covers to maintain a clean and healthy sleep environment. BEDGEAR is represented in more than 4,000 retail stores across the globe and has earned more than 220 U.S. and worldwide patents, trademark registrations and pending applications. Job Summary:
The Senior Graphic Designer is responsible for developing innovative, high-quality visual solutions that support BEDGEAR’s brand identity, marketing initiatives, and retail experience. This role translates business and marketing objectives into cohesive visual concepts that strengthen brand storytelling across multiple channels, including marketing collateral, packaging, in-store graphics, and trade show environments. The position requires a balance of conceptual thinking and technical execution, ensuring all creative materials are visually compelling, strategically aligned, and consistent with BEDGEAR’s brand standards.
Essential Functions (included but not limited to):
- Develop graphic design solutions across all customer touchpoints—both digital and print—including performance and brand advertising, packaging, marketing collateral, in-store graphics.
- Develop in-store graphics, signage, and point-of-purchase displays that highlight product performance and drive retail engagement.
- Create packaging, hangtags, and labels that align with brand standards, retail guidelines, and overall visual identity.
- Collaborate cross-functionally with creative, marketing, and product teams to design trade show booths, event environments, and visual experiences that bring the brand to life.
- Manage multiple design projects simultaneously, maintaining timelines, accuracy, and brand consistency across all deliverables.
- Contribute innovative ideas and design concepts that enhance BEDGEAR’s B2B presence and B2C reflect the brand’s performance-driven identity.
- Stay informed on industry trends, emerging design technologies, and best practices to continuously elevate creative quality and impact.
- Support additional creative initiatives and special projects as assigned.
